- 博客(50)
- 收藏
- 关注
原创 高效批量插入数据
开启批处理,关闭自动提交事务,共用同一个SqlSession之后,for循环单条插入的性能得到实质性的提高;由于同一个SqlSession省去对资源相关操作的耗能、减少对事务处理的时间等,从而极大程度上提高执行效率。
2023-04-11 10:15:08
485
原创 @Transactional报错时回滚失败,开始手动回滚
Transactional报错时需要抛出异常被注解自带的异常处理捕获才能够自动回滚,但在为了尽量能够回复响应,我们都会自己捕获异常,如果我们捕获了异常就不能自动回滚,这个时候我们就需要开启手动回滚。
2023-04-08 01:37:10
697
原创 lombok@Data注解和spring识别getting,setting差异
当使用@RequestBody注解时,使用的是spring的形式,如果采用了lombok那就需要自己写getting和setting方法,并且最好两种getting和setting都实现。当字段为uId,这种第一个字符为小写,第二个字符是大写的情况时,@Data生成的getting和setting为。在其他数据转换实体时,会变成null,也就是没有找到对应的setting方法。而spring的识别的getting和setting为。
2023-04-08 01:23:49
243
MySQL和redis事务问题
2023-11-07
TA创建的收藏夹 TA关注的收藏夹
TA关注的人